Grenzenlose Datensammelei braucht weltweiten Datenschutz

Im Namen der Datenschutzbehörden in der EU hat die WP29 Datenschutzgruppe Briefe an die 3 großen Suchmaschinenbetreiber Google, Yahoo und Microsoft geschickt. Bereits im März 2008 hatte die Arbeitsgruppe Google auf die europäischen Datenschutzprinzipien hingewiesen.

In den folgenden Gesprächen (Feb. 2009) hatte die EU darauf hingewiesen, dass
“Even where an IP address and cookie are replaced by a unique identifier,
the correlation of stored search queries may allow individuals to be identified.”

Google hatte daraufhin versprochen, die IP Nummern für 9 Monate nur anonymisiert zu speichern. Allerdings weist die EU Arbeitsgruppe darauf hin, dass
Additionally, deleting the last octet of the IP-addresses is insufficient to guarantee adequate anonymisation. Such a partial deletion does not prevent identifiability of data subjects. In addition to this, you state you retain cookies for a period of 18 months. This would allow for the correlation of individual search queries for a considerable length of time. It also appears to allow for easy retrieval of IP-addresses, every time a user makes a new query within those 18 months. Therefore, WP29 cannot conclude your company complies with the European data protection directive.

... und sieht darin einen Verstoß gegen die EU Datenschutzrichtline, den sie mit Besorgnis der Kommission meldet.
